Asian Businesses in a Turbulent Environment: Uncertainty and Coping Strategies

Asian economies today command much attention from scholars and practitioners, yet they continue to face crises and challenges such as globalization, regional conflict, pressure for greater transparency and environmental protection to name but a few. Asian Businesses in a Turbulent Environment explores how Asian firms cope with these challenges, and the impact that rising above them will have on their growth prospects. Starting with a conceptual analysis of crises and their impact on local markets and societies, this book examines leadership styles for conflict management, as well as strategies adopted by various Asian firms including the location choice and entry mode, knowledge transfer, cultural shifts, social capital and knowledge development, and environmental management in the supply chain.
